1. Retro Arcade Paradise

This element injects energy and a playful vibe into your basement. Neon glow, chrome accents, and wall posters instantly signal a throwback arcade vibe. Think bright blues, hot pinks, and black matte walls with a row of classic cabinets lining the wall. Pinterest loves these retro game room looks for bold, nostalgic style.
To bring it home, blend budget finds with smart tech. A MAME cabinet or Raspberry Pi setup can cover dozens of classics without breaking the bank. Paint the walls in a deep shade and add LED strips for a neon glow. Keep a comfy seating nook so friends and family can regroup after each round.

This layout turns the basement into a warm home theater. A big screen or projector anchors the room, while bean bags and a plush rug invite lounging. A popcorn machine and a snack bar keep treats within reach, and fairy lights soften the space. Pinterest loves cozy cinema corners for family nights, and this look fits right in.
Focus on simple, affordable steps: use blackout curtains or heavy drapes to sharpen picture quality, and borrow or buy a secondhand projector. Layer in soft seating and throw pillows to blend comfort with tech. Build movie nights around themes to keep everyone excited, from classics to kids’ picks. What basement design tips can help me create a true home entertainment space?
Start with a plan that separates sound areas from the rest: use acoustic panels or thick curtains, a quality projector or TV with proper distance, and comfortable seating. Prioritize basement design tips like moisture control, proper insulation, and controlled lighting. Create zones for home entertainment spaces — a gaming corner, a movie nook, and a casual chat area. Choose a cohesive color scheme and durable materials for high-traffic use. Invest in a solid sound system and cable management to keep basement game room ideas uncluttered. Finally, round out the space with themed decor and kid-safe storage to support long-term usability.
